About The Position

The Virtual Chief Information Officer (vCIO) serves as the technical strategist, filling the technology leadership gap in a client's environment. This role owns the client's technology strategy and roadmap, sets direction, and translates technical realities into business decisions. The vCIO acts as the primary technology leader for clients lacking their own, or supplements existing technology leadership.

Responsibilities

  • Own the technology roadmap, being accountable for the client's technology plan and its strategic direction.
  • Set direction by working with the client to determine the future state of their environment and the order of operations, aligned with their business goals.
  • Translate technical findings into business terms, identifying threats, costs, and the urgency of issues.
  • Lead executive engagement, serving as the client's trusted technology advisor at the leadership level and guiding strategic conversations.
  • Guide investment and budget planning by providing leadership during IT budget and technology investment planning.
  • Shape discovery into strategy by incorporating technical discovery and assessment from the delivery team into the roadmap as priorities and direction.
  • Surface strategic opportunities through the roadmap, identifying where technology can reduce costs, mitigate risks, and advance the client's business, and shaping these opportunities for the account team.
  • Maintain an understanding of the client's environment and business to ensure the roadmap remains relevant as both evolve.
